3 keeper league:

Faulk, Ricky W., Deuce M.(i also have bruce and T. brown)

could get Rod Smith for Deuce.

I hate keeping 3 backs when we start 1qb, 2rb, 3wr. Thoughts, comments, suggested moves???

Depth like that is never a bad thing to have at RB and I would be more than happy to carry the 3 of them into a draft. However, getting Rod Smith for McAllister would be a great move. An even better idea would be to try to trade McAllister and Bruce for an even better WR (Moss, Owens, Harrison, Boston). It depends on your league rules and the other owners situations but if you can turn 2 good keepers like McAllister and Bruce into 1 great keeper from a team that lacks 3 true keepers, that would be huge.

I simply continue to be baffled over and over when I see how little respect Marvin Harrison continues to get...why isn't this guy the clear #1 WR????

His last 3 years:

1999 115receptions 1663yards 12TD
2000 102receptions 1413yards 14TD
2001 109receptions 1524yards 15TD

Am I missing something?
